using System;
using System.Text.RegularExpressions;
public class Example
{
public static void Main()
{
string pattern = @"\b49=[^|]+";
string input = @"8=FIXT1.1|9=709|35=y|34=53|49=DUMMYBROKER|56=<client_ID>|52=20210211- 12:12:37.358847|55=AUD/CAD|55=AUD/CHF|55=AUD/JPY|55=AUD/NZD|55=AUD/USD|55= CAD/CHF|55=CAD/JPY|55=CHF/JPY|55=EUR/AUD|55=EUR/CAD|55=EUR/CHF";
RegexOptions options = RegexOptions.Multiline;
foreach (Match m in Regex.Matches(input, pattern, options))
{
Console.WriteLine("'{0}' found at index {1}.", m.Value, m.Index);
}
}
}
